Drug Abuse Statistics in Illinois

Over 2,200 people died of opioid overdoses in Illinois in 2017. The state’s rate of 17.2 deaths per 100,000 residents is almost 20% higher than the national opioid overdose death rate. Each year, over 5,000 people in Illinois lose their lives due to alcohol or drugs. If you need help with drugs or alcohol, you can find a drug treatment center in IL that can help.

How to Stop Alcohol and Drug Cravings

Once you resolve to stop drinking or using drugs, your road to recovery is a lifelong process of saying no to your cravings. It can be challenging to figure out how to stop alcohol and drug cravings. Each person has a different set of physical and psychological triggers. With help from a drug and alcohol detox center, you can learn different strategies for reducing cravings and managing withdrawal symptoms.
